How much do English tutors charge near me?

English tutors charge $25 to $80 per hour on average, depending on their experience, education level, location, and availability. Expect to pay $15 to $40 per hour when hiring a high school aged English tutor and $30 to $100 per hour for a certified English teacher with a degree.

What do private English tutors do?

English tutors help students with reading, writing, grammar, spelling, vocabulary, phonics, and speaking skills. English tutors assist students by reviewing and critiquing essays, increasing their reading comprehension, or improving their writing skills. English tutors also work with students in English as a Second Language (ESL) programs.

What do ESL tutors do?

ESL (English as a Second Language) tutors help students who speak different primary languages learn formal English speaking, writing, grammar, and vocabulary. ESL teachers overcome language barriers to help students communicate clearly in English.

How to find an English tutor in my area?

Start by searching our list of private ESL, reading, and writing tutors. Then follow these tips:

  • Contact and consult with at least three tutors before hiring.
  • Read their reviews, ask for references, and verify their education.
  • Discuss where the lessons will take place, the cost, and cancellation policies.
  • Ask what payment methods are accepted and when payment is due.
  • Ask about discounts for booking a package of lessons.
  • Hire the tutor on a trail basis to make sure they are a good fit.
